Hyundai Ioniq: Fuel Delivery System / Fuel Filter. Repair procedures
1. | Remove the fuel pump. (Refer to Fuel Delivery System - "Fuel Pump") |
2. | Disconnect the fuel pump motor connector (A) and fuel sender connector (B). |
3. | Press the fixing hook (A) with a driver and then remove fuel sender (B) in the arrow direction. |
4. | Disconnect the fuel feed tube (B) after removing the fixing pin (A). |
5. | Remove the head assembly (B) after releasing the fixing hooks (A). |
6. | Remove the reservoir-cup (B) after releasing the fixing hooks (A). |
7. | Disconnect the ground line (A). |
8. | Disconnect the fuel pump motor connector (A). |
9. | Disconnect the fuel pressure regulator (B) after removing the fixing pin (A). |
10. | Remove the free filter p (B) after releasing the fixing hooks (A). |
11. | Remove the fuel pump motor (A) from the fuel filter. |
12. | Remove the fuel filter from the bracket after releasing the fixing hooks (A). |
1. | Install in the reverse order of removal. |
